The title says it all. Usually I build
Doran shield
boots(normal)
atma's impaler
wit's end

Mercury treads
sunfire cape

Warmog

So with this build I have around 187 ad(depending on war's bonus), with around 50% mr and 63% armor. I was wondering, would I be better off going for the black cleaver for more damage or beefing myself further with GA?

Guardian angel.
TBC is really more of an early game item if you are ahead. It's more to keep the dominance rather than gain it.
It works well with the conditional stun you have though.

Thanks for the input guys, but that's just a rough outline of my build order. I build what things tailored to the enemy team composition and what money I have. If my enemy team was heavy ap like jax or brand, I would rush merc treads and wit's end. By that same token, I'd go with atma's and doran's shield for ad.

Luigignaf: I see where you're coming from and agree to a point. Being incredibly fed allows you to build tbc early. :3 If you build it later without tankiness, it's effectiveness dwindles.

Pozsich: I usually build two mantles on rene, rather than opting out for merc treads. It's an expensive item and the movement speed is not important, nor is the tenacity if there is little cc in my lane.

DDRmagic: We play differently, I go for cheap items which increase my defensive and offensive capabilities. If I got sunfire and warmogs, it's because the game lasted almost an hour. Renek is not a good ad champion, he lacks any sort of range or utility to survive a teamfight. Unlike tryn, he has no invulnerability. Unlike yi, he doesn't have immunity to slows.

Though I will say an early atma's is not a waste. I understand the sentiment, the damage it gives early on is less than 30. The key lies in wht type of champion rene is. From this one purchase, I get a 1/5-6 chance to crit, two of which from from my stun. I get armor to reduce early ad champion damage, and ofcourse damage simply by building health.

Doran's shield,boots,doran's sword, atma's,magic mantle only costs around 3.8k gold and it gives me around 127 attack damage, along with all the mr and armor.

I generally feel 2500 HP is enough to warrant the purchase of an Atma's in a lot of games.

Warmogg's is purchased for survivability.

Atma's is purchased for a little surivability and a little damage.

The purchase of one does not instantly require the purchase of the other and the build order is not set in stone.

Yes there is build efficiency but for a champion like Renek I can understand reversal of purchase order.
